As the doors opened, everyone turned to look, watching as the pale girl walked in. Every person smiled, and waved, though the only people that she cared to acknowledge was the ones that she thought was good looking enough for her time. This was her place, and these were her people.
As she walked into the back, the laser lights seemed to bounce off her porcelain skin. Going to the side of the stage, ignoring every hand that reached out to her, except for one. She saw the man, and looking him over quickly. Then she grabbed his hand, and lead him to the side of the stage with her. The security guards moved to the side, not even bothering to ID the girl, or the man. Everyone knew Sayomi.
As they entered the room, everyone passed her drinks, and she drank them just as fast as people were handing them to her. She stopped, and turned looking at the man that she dragged a long with her. She gave him a kiss, then let go of his hand, and then went into a door, leaving him with people that he didn't know.
As she entered the room, she sat on a stool, and a mixture of people began applying neon paint to her long silky black hair, applying make up to her face and stomach, and applied a multitude of lights to her outfit, hair and around her legs. As she watched in the mirror as the subtle girl that existed outside of this club slowly disappeared, revealing the girl that she wished that she would be.
"Sai! Your here! I thought you weren't going to show up!" Her manager yelled at her as he entered the room. He came up behind her, and kissed her cheek that had no make up on. I have something for you, that you will greatly enjoy tonight" He muttered in her ear, with a sinister smile. "Time to forget that old man of yours, and enjoy yourself!" With a fluid motion, he opened her mouth, and popped in a piece of paper, then held her mouth shut. At first, she tried to fight, but after a few seconds, and the paper dissolved she knew that what was about to happen.
Quickly, she brought her hand up and slapped him. As she opened her mouth to yell, the music turned up, and the bass started to bump the entire club. Echoing throughout the surrounding neighborhoods. She looked at him, as she was dragged off by one of the girls. It was time to do what she was there to do.
Walking out onto the stage, the crowd of people cheered, screaming so loud that it drowned out most of the sound of the music. She smiled as they all started to call out of her name. Outside of these walls, Sayomi was a quiet and shy mouse. She never would even speak out of turn, but here, she was in control. She was the master, the one that everyone looked to.
She threw her arms up in the air, almost falling backwards. She could start to feel the acid kick in. Her mind didn't feel like it normally did. Without hesitation, as the bass dropped, her body moved. It flowed fluidly, no hesitations, no paused, just a nonstop array of seductive moves, every eye concentration her for the time being.
